Day-by-Day Itinerary

Day 1: Arrival in Macedonia

Your guide will meet you at the airport and transfer you to your hotel in Skopje. Depending on arrival time, we’ll enjoy a short city tour before gathering for a welcome dinner and trip briefing.

Day 2: Vodno Mountain & Matka Canyon

We begin with a cable car ride to Mount Vodno (1,060 m) and hike down towards the breathtaking Matka Canyon, passing a 14th-century cliffside monastery. After exploring Matka, we transfer to Bitola, Macedonia’s cultural gem.
Distance: 12 km | 3–4 hrs | ↑0 m ↓740 m

Day 3: Pelister National Park: Molika Pines & Bee Farm

A short transfer brings us to Pelister National Park, famous for its 5-needle Molika pines found only in the Balkans. We hike through peaceful forests to scenic viewpoints before enjoying a homemade village lunch and visiting a local bee farm.
Distance: 12 km | 4 hrs | ↑400 m ↓400 m

Day 4: Malovista Village & Pelister Peaks

We hike from Malovista, the only village inside Pelister National Park. The trail passes monasteries, oak forests, and alpine meadows, reaching over 2,000 m with stunning views of Prespa Lake. In the afternoon, we transfer to Ohrid, where we stay for the next 3 nights.
Distance: 10 km | 5 hrs | ↑870 m ↓870 m

Day 5: Rest Day in Ohrid

Guided city tour UNESCO city of Ohrid, visit the monastery St.Naum. Optional activities: Kayaking / SUP / Sailing on Lake Ohrid. 

Day 6: Galicica National Park: Villages & Lake Views

Today’s hike connects picturesque mountain villages above Lake Ohrid. From Velestovo, we hike to Elen Peak and descend through old stone villages to the lake. After a cultural visit at the Bay of Bones museum, we enjoy lunch in the fishing village of Trpejca and return to Ohrid by boat.
Distance: 10 km | 3 hrs | ↑130 m ↓310 m

Day 7: Mavrovo National Park & Monasteries

After breakfast, we checked out from the hotel and drove to Mavrovo National Park for a gentle hike from Lazaropole village to Sokolica Peak (1,460 m). We then visit Rostuše Waterfall and the 11th-century St. Jovan Bigorski Monastery before a farewell dinner in Skopje.
Distance: 5 km | 2 hrs | ↑200 m ↓200 m

Day 8: Departure from Skopje

Transfer to Skopje Airport based on your flight schedule—end of the tour.
